Side Impacts of Methasterone
While methasterone can offer some potential benefits, its usage isn't without grave risks. Individuals who employ this compound may experience a range of detrimental side effects. These frequently involve complications related to cardiovascular health, including high blood pressure and an elevated risk heart attacks or strokes. Liver damage is another significant threat associated with methasterone use, as it can put excessive strain on this vital organ. Furthermore, users may suffer from acne, mood swings, aggression, and hair loss. It's important to note that the severity of these side effects fluctuates significantly depending on the dosage used, individual reactivity, and overall health status.

The Anabolic Effects of Activity Science Behind
Methasterone, a potent synthetic anabolic steroid, exerts its effects through a complex interplay involving hormonal pathways. Primarily, it binds to androgen receptors, activating protein synthesis and ultimately leading to increased muscle mass and strength. This binding is particularly strong, due to Methasterone's chemical structure which mimics testosterone. Furthermore, Methasterone exhibits a unique ability to regulate the production of other hormones, such as growth hormone and cortisol, further contributing to its anabolic impact.
